Case Study of Heavy Rainfall in Southeast Asia during Winter Monsoon

摘要

Based on the mentioned-above, the following conclusion can be drawn: (1) in winter season, the cold air outbreaks over East Asia is one of the most significant weather events of whiter over the northern hemisphere, and extremely dry and cold air invades from Siberia to Mongolia, North China, Korea, even to Southeast Asia. (2) The majority of occasions of heavy rainfall over South Thailand, Malaysia and South China Sea are due to tropical disturbances developing along the low level near equatorial trough around 5°-10°N. (3) The strong convection activities in lower latitude area triggered by the cold surge, not only influence the local weather in tropical region, but also is one kind of feedback on the atmospheric general circulation, and it probably enhances the Hadley circulation. (4) In winter monsoon, there existed the pronounced interaction between multi-scale systems and between both hemispheres. Therefore, it should be paid more attention, especially, to study of the general circulation and weather system in southern hemisphere in future.
